
Health Psychology by Edward P Sarafino
This is an introductory health psychology text that shows how biological, psychological, gender and socio-cultural factors interact to impact on health and healthcare. It takes a lifespan approach to show how health concerns change from childhood through to old age and covers such topics as AIDS, drug and alcohol abuse, eating and nutrition and stress. In-depth discussions on methods and programs for health promotion are provided and vignettes, examples and cases appear throughout to hold the student's interest in this rapidly changing field.Edward P. Sarafino is a professor of psychology and is on the board of trustees for The College of New Jersey. He received his BA from Chico State University and his doctorate from the University of Colorado.
